Frequently Asked Questions

When is hiring a real estate attorney in Chesterfield, NJ, required versus just recommended?

In New Jersey, an attorney is required to conduct the closing for any real estate transaction, making their involvement mandatory for buying or selling property in Chesterfield. It's also highly recommended to hire one for reviewing complex contracts, dealing with title issues specific to Burlington County, or navigating Chesterfield's zoning ordinances for land use.

What are common local issues a Chesterfield real estate attorney can help with regarding property transactions?

A local attorney can address issues specific to Chesterfield's rural character and Burlington County regulations, such as verifying percolation tests for septic systems, ensuring compliance with local farmland preservation ordinances, and reviewing easements for shared driveways common in the area. They also handle standard title searches to uncover any liens or restrictions on the property.

How do fee structures for real estate attorneys typically work in Chesterfield, NJ?

Most real estate attorneys in Chesterfield charge a flat fee for standard residential transactions, which covers contract review, title search coordination, and closing services. This fee can vary but is often between $1,200 and $2,500. For more complex matters like litigation or land development, they typically bill by the hour.

What should I look for when choosing a real estate attorney in Chesterfield?

Look for an attorney or firm with extensive experience in New Jersey real estate law and specific familiarity with Burlington County procedures and Chesterfield Township's local ordinances. It's beneficial to choose someone located nearby for easy document access and who has strong relationships with local title companies and surveyors.

Can a Chesterfield real estate attorney help with disputes over property boundaries or right-of-way issues common in more rural areas?

Yes, absolutely. Local attorneys are skilled in resolving boundary disputes, which can involve reviewing historical surveys and deeds unique to Chesterfield's older properties. They can also negotiate or litigate right-of-way and easement issues, which are common with shared private roads and long driveways in the township's less densely populated areas.
